TURN-208: Gatevale turnstile counters at the Merrow Field pilot double-count when a rotation reverses mid-cycle. Attendance totals drift roughly 2% high per event. The debounce window fix is implemented, reviewed by Ilsa, and soak-tested across two simulated match days without drift. Ready for your cut; the candidate build is identified below.

trace token, tagag-tafog: htk6_5ed18c

CI note for weekly sync: the Larkwell integration suite intermittently fails when the pooler in quartz-db exhausts connections during parallel migration tests. We lowered max pool size to 12 and added a 30s idle reaper, which cleared three of four flakes. The remaining failure reproduces only on runner group B; the offending run is identified below.

pipeline stamp: htk9_ce63042d9

**Q: How does the guest Wi-Fi desk at reception work?**

Guests connect at the small desk left of the Ashworth Building reception counter. No staff escort needed for Wi-Fi only; building access still requires sign-in. The desk terminal prints a voucher valid until 18:00. Facilities staff reset the terminal each morning. The reset panel behind the counter unlocks with the code below.

turnstile pass: bdg-FVNQRS-72965873

## Runbook: Inventory Reconciliation Job (Storroway)

The reconciliation job runs nightly at 02:10 and compares warehouse counts against the Ledgerline totals. Discrepancies over 0.5% page the on-call; smaller drift is logged and reviewed at the weekly sync. If the job stalls, check the lock table before restarting — a duplicate run corrupts the delta report. Manual reruns require a direct connection to the reconciliation database, using the string below.

replica DSN, tawef-hahap: mysql://eliix_svc:FiIC0jz@db-394a.lumiclabs.internal:5432/holius